Hiking around Lake Wysockie, located near Gdańsk, Poland, offers a variety of trails for outdoor enthusiasts. The region is characterized by its lake environment, providing opportunities for walks along the water and through surrounding areas. The terrain generally features moderate elevation changes, suitable for different hiking abilities.

December 1, 2024, Embankment of the Kokoszki–Gdynia Railway Line

On the other side of the bypass it connects with the current Starodwodcowa Street. The line opened to traffic in 1921, it was a rail access to Gdynia bypassing the Free City of Gdańsk. In the years 1926-1933 it was rebuilt in its current form during the construction of the Bydgoszcz-Gdynia railway line.

At this point, we reach the Source called The Source of Mary In 1921, a Polish railway line from Gdynia to Kokoszki was built here, bypassing the Free City of Gdańsk. One day there was a serious accident at the construction site. Workers used turf to strengthen the slopes of the slope. The sod was transported in wagons from the side of Osowa. There were trees all around, the road was winding and visibility was limited. At some point, one of the wagons broke away from the rest of the train and began to move straight towards the workers who were just having a lunch break. They were resting by the railroad tracks when they suddenly heard a rumble and managed to dodge the car coming at high speed. The workers decided that they owed their miraculous rescue to the Blessed Virgin Mary and, out of gratitude for saving their life, built a chapel with her figure on a stone plinth in the middle of the pond by the spring. https://pl.wikipedia.org/wiki/%C5%B9r%C3%B3d%C5%82o_Marii_(kapliczka)

Frequently Asked Questions

How many hiking trails are available around Lake Wysockie?

There are over 400 hiking routes recorded around Lake Wysockie on komoot, offering a wide variety of options for all skill levels.

What kind of terrain can I expect on hikes around Lake Wysockie?

The terrain around Lake Wysockie generally features moderate elevation changes, with paths along the water and through surrounding areas. You'll find a mix of lake-side paths and varied local terrain.

Are there easy hiking options suitable for beginners or families?

Yes, a significant portion of the trails around Lake Wysockie are rated as easy. For example, the Gdańsk Osowa Railway Station loop from Gdańsk Osowa is an easy 4.4-mile path exploring the area.

What is the average difficulty of hikes in the Lake Wysockie area?

The routes around Lake Wysockie offer a range of difficulties. Out of over 400 tours, 257 are easy, 136 are moderate, and 11 are difficult, indicating a good balance for various hiking abilities.

What do other hikers say about the trails around Lake Wysockie?

The area is high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.7 stars from over 550 reviews. Hikers often praise the varied local terrain and the opportunities for walks along the water.

Are there any longer hiking routes for more experienced hikers?

Yes, for those looking for a longer challenge, the Valley of Clear Water – Węglowa Road loop from Osowa is a moderate 8.8-mile (14.2 km) trail that takes around 3 hours 45 minutes to complete.

Can I find circular hiking routes around Lake Wysockie?

Many of the trails in the area are designed as loops. Examples include the popular Hiking loop from Gdańsk Osowa and the Mary's Spring loop from Osowa, both offering circular paths.

Where is Lake Wysockie located?

Lake Wysockie is located near Gdańsk, Poland, specifically in the area of Gdańsk Osowa.

What is the typical duration for a hike around Lake Wysockie?

Hike durations vary depending on the route's length and your pace. For instance, the Hiking loop from Gdańsk Osowa typically takes about 2 hours, while the Mary's Spring loop from Osowa is closer to 2 hours 48 minutes.

Are there moderate difficulty trails available?

Absolutely. Many trails are rated as moderate, providing a good balance for hikers. The Mary's Spring – Underpass on the Black Trail loop from Osowa is a moderate 5.2-mile (8.4 km) route.
